The Montreal Canadiens announced on Friday that the team has recalled forward Joshua Roy from the AHL’s Laval Rocket. He will join the team Saturday morning.

The 20-year-old winger played in two preseason games with the Canadiens during training camp but has yet to make his NHL debut. Through the 2023-24 AHL regular season, Roy has 12 goals and 18 assists through 34 games with the Rocket.

He was named AHL Rookie of the Month for October 2023, having recorded five goals and seven assists for 12 points in seven games.

Drafted by the Habs in the fifth round of the 2021 NHL Entry Draft, Roy spent four seasons in the QMJHL, recording 135 goals and 162 asssists for 297 points, with a career-high 119 points (51 goals and 68 assists) with the Sherbrooke Phoenix in 2021-22, which earned him the Jean Beliveau Trophy for the league’s top scorer.

Roy was selected first overall in the 2019 QMJHL Amateur Draft after scoring 38 goals and 50 assists for 88 points in 42 games with the Levis Chevaliers of the Quebec U16 Triple-A Hockey League.

Roy also won two gold medals with Canada at the 2022 and 2023 World Junior Championships.
